Name edit

"The club was founded in 1896 and was named after Edward Banfield.."

I'd rather say that the club was named after the Buenos Aires village that was named after Edward Banfield. That's a difference in my opinion. -Lemmy- (talk) 20:31, 23 October 2008 (UTC)Reply
I have modified the intro to reflect this EP 22:16, 23 October 2008 (UTC)Reply

Daniel Kingsland edit

Apologies if this entry violates one of the Wikipedia rules - I'm new to this.

Daniel Kingsland is noted in this article to have been an accountant. I am a descendent of Daniel Kingsland (G-G-grandson) and I have been researching him. To date, I have found nothing to support the claim that he was an accountant. He was a coach driver for many years in Australia and New Zealand, before going to Argentina, and prior to that, he was a seaman. Is the author able to provide a citation about Daniel's accountancy credentials?Wallabyphil (talk) 01:32, 30 July 2012 (UTC)Reply
